NASHVILLE, Tenn. (AP) -- A fugitive on Tennessee's Top Ten Most Wanted was captured in Alabama after police said he tried to rape and kill a Lebanon woman in March.
Authorities tracked 55-year-old Ronnie Cloyd, of LaVergne, at a Wal-Mart in Athens, Ala., where he surrendered without a struggle.
Cloyd was wanted by the Wilson County Sheriff's Office for attempted murder, criminal attempt to commit aggravated rape and criminal attempt to commit aggravated kidnapping. He was added to the list less than two weeks ago.
